Ultimately, the Lm318h Datasheet empowers engineers to make informed decisions about how to use the LM318H effectively. Within the datasheet, you will find the absolute maximum values which are important to keep in mind. For example:
- Supply Voltage: +- 18V
- Input Voltage: +- 15V
- Differential Input Voltage: +- 30V
| Parameter | Value | Unit |
|---|---|---|
| Slew Rate | 50 | V/μs |
| Gain Bandwidth Product | 15 | MHz |
